Three-dimensional simulation of jet formation in collapsing condensates
2003
Journal of Physics B: Atomic, Molecular and Optical Physics
We numerically study the behavior of collapsing and exploding condensates using the parameters of the experiments by E.A. Donley et al. [Nature, 412, 295, (2001)]. Our studies are based on a full three-dimensional numerical solution of the Gross-Pitaevskii equation (GPE) including three body loss.
